Transaction 2604e2977ef2b99c79705328e4ed68277c14bb40f3725c5ae74577bc8ca9e125

2 Input
2 Outputs
  • 2604e2977ef2b99c79705328e4ed68277c14bb40f3725c5ae74577bc8ca9e125:0
  • value  17542705
    address  1B8Cwj9DvyXGVzV9V3q3vG5FdZDucLTstw
  • 2604e2977ef2b99c79705328e4ed68277c14bb40f3725c5ae74577bc8ca9e125:1
  • value  180000
    address  18bhYGjA9SJeT3919FzY6evreMP13iEvJA